Parkinson’s disease (PD) is a progressive neurological disorder that affects movement control, leading to tremors, rigidity, and bradykinesia (slowness of movement). While there is no cure for Parkinson’s, physiotherapy plays a crucial role in managing symptoms and improving the quality of life for individuals living with this condition. Creating a Safe Living Environment: Making modifications to the home environment can help reduce the risk of falls and injuries. This includes installing grab bars, removing tripping hazards, and using non-slip mats.
Incorporating Regular Exercise: Establishing a consistent exercise routine can help manage symptoms and improve overall health.
Engaging in Social Activities: Maintaining social interactions and engaging in activities can enhance emotional well-being and quality of life.
Monitoring and Adjusting Medications: Regularly consulting with healthcare providers to adjust medications as needed is crucial for effective symptom management.
